Business Plumbing in Denver, CO
Business plumbing services encompass a wide range of projects essential to maintaining the functionality and safety of commercial properties, including office buildings, retail stores, restaurants, and other business facilities. These services typically cover installations, repairs, and upgrades of plumbing systems such as water supply lines, drainage, fixtures, and emergency leak repairs. Property owners often seek these services to address issues like persistent leaks, clogged drains, or outdated piping systems, as well as for new construction or renovation projects requiring reliable plumbing infrastructure.
Before requesting business plumbing services, property owners should understand the scope of work needed, including the specific plumbing fixtures or systems involved and any existing issues that require attention. Clarifying the nature of the project, whether it involves repairs, replacements, or new installations, helps ensure the appropriate solutions are provided. It’s also useful to have information about the property’s plumbing layout, age, and any previous repairs, to facilitate efficient service planning and execution.

Common Business Plumbing Jobs
Drain Cleaning - clearing clogged drains to prevent backups and water damage.
Fixture Installation - replacing or upgrading sinks, faucets, and toilets for improved function.
Leak Repairs - fixing drips and leaks to conserve water and prevent property damage.
Pipe Repairs - addressing burst or damaged pipes to restore proper water flow.
Water Heater Services - installing, repairing, or maintaining water heaters for reliable hot water.
Emergency Plumbing - responding to urgent plumbing issues to minimize property disruption.
